Post processor vagrant failing

MacOS 15.4.1
Packer v1.12.0
$ packer plugin installed
/Users/rwideman/.config/packer/plugins/github.com/hashicorp/ansible/packer-plugin-ansible_v1.1.3_x5.0_darwin_arm64
/Users/rwideman/.config/packer/plugins/github.com/hashicorp/vagrant/packer-plugin-vagrant_v1.1.5_x5.0_darwin_arm64
/Users/rwideman/.config/packer/plugins/github.com/hashicorp/virtualbox/packer-plugin-virtualbox_v1.1.1_x5.0_darwin_arm64
/Users/rwideman/.config/packer/plugins/github.com/hashicorp/vmware/packer-plugin-vmware_v1.1.0_x5.0_darwin_arm64

This code works.
packer {
required_plugins {
vmware = {
version = “>= 1.1.0”
source = “github.com/hashicorp/vmware
}
vagrant = {
version = “>= 1.1.5”
source = “GitHub - hashicorp/vagrant: Vagrant is a tool for building and distributing development environments.
}
}
}
source “vmware-vmx” “vmware” {
source_path = “~/Virtual Machines.localized/Debian12.vmx”
communicator = “ssh”
ssh_username = “vagrant”
ssh_password = “vagrant”
shutdown_command = “sudo poweroff”
}

build {
sources = [“source.vmware-vmx.vmware”]
post-processor “vagrant” {
keep_input_artifact = false
output = “debian12.box”
}
}

Now I am trying to use a box already uploaded to HCP and everything works until post-processor “vagrant” starts.
source “vagrant” “debian12-arm64” {
source_path = “rwideman/debian12-arm64”
provider = “vmware_desktop”
communicator = “ssh”
add_force = true
#box_name = “debian12-arm64”
}

build {
sources = [“source.vagrant.debian12-arm64”]
provisioner “shell” {
inline = [
“echo Updating Packages”,
“sudo apt update && sudo apt upgrade -y”,
]
}
provisioner “shell” {
inline = [“sudo reboot”]
expect_disconnect = true
pause_before = “1m”
}
post-processor “vagrant” {
keep_input_artifact = false
output = “/Users/rwideman/code/packer/debian12/debian12-arm64.box”
}
}

Logs:
2025/04/27 21:33:37 ui: e[1;32m==> vagrant.debian12-arm64: Packaging box…e[0m
2025/04/27 21:33:37 packer-plugin-vagrant_v1.1.5_x5.0_darwin_arm64 plugin: 2025/04/27 21:33:37 Calling Vagrant CLI: string{“package”, “source”, “–output”, “package.box”}
2025/04/27 21:33:39 packer-plugin-vagrant_v1.1.5_x5.0_darwin_arm64 plugin: 2025/04/27 21:33:39 [vagrant driver] stdout: ==> source: Attempting graceful shutdown of VM…
2025/04/27 21:33:43 packer-plugin-vagrant_v1.1.5_x5.0_darwin_arm64 plugin: 2025/04/27 21:33:43 [vagrant driver] stdout: ==> source: Exporting VM…
2025/04/27 21:33:47 packer-plugin-vagrant_v1.1.5_x5.0_darwin_arm64 plugin: 2025/04/27 21:33:47 [vagrant driver] stdout: ==> source: Compressing package to: /Users/rwideman/code/packer/debian12/output-debian12-arm64/package.box
2025/04/27 21:35:50 ui: e[1;32m==> vagrant.debian12-arm64: destroying Vagrant box…e[0m
2025/04/27 21:35:50 packer-plugin-vagrant_v1.1.5_x5.0_darwin_arm64 plugin: 2025/04/27 21:35:50 Calling Vagrant CLI: string{“destroy”, “-f”, “source”}
2025/04/27 21:35:53 packer-plugin-vagrant_v1.1.5_x5.0_darwin_arm64 plugin: 2025/04/27 21:35:53 [vagrant driver] stdout: ==> source: Deleting the VM…
2025/04/27 21:35:53 [INFO] (telemetry) ending vagrant.debian12-arm64
2025/04/27 21:35:53 ui: e[1;32m==> vagrant.debian12-arm64: Running post-processor: (type vagrant)e[0m
2025/04/27 21:35:53 [INFO] (telemetry) Starting post-processor vagrant
2025/04/27 21:35:53 [DEBUG] - common: receiving ConfigSpec as gob
2025/04/27 21:35:53 packer-plugin-vagrant_v1.1.5_x5.0_darwin_arm64 plugin: 2025/04/27 21:35:53 error: Unknown artifact type, can’t build box: vagrant
2025/04/27 21:35:53 [INFO] (telemetry) ending vagrant
2025/04/27 21:35:53 Deleting original artifact for build ‘vagrant.debian12-arm64’
2025/04/27 21:35:53 ui error: e[1;31mBuild ‘vagrant.debian12-arm64’ errored after 7 minutes 43 seconds: 1 error(s) occurred:

  • Post-processor failed: Unknown artifact type, can’t build box: vagrante[0m
    2025/04/27 21:35:53 ui:
    ==> Wait completed after 7 minutes 43 seconds
    2025/04/27 21:35:53 machine readable: error-count string{“1”}
    2025/04/27 21:35:53 ui error:
    ==> Some builds didn’t complete successfully and had errors:
    2025/04/27 21:35:53 machine readable: vagrant.debian12-arm64,error string{“1 error(s) occurred:\n\n* Post-processor failed: Unknown artifact type, can’t build box: vagrant”}
    2025/04/27 21:35:53 ui error: → vagrant.debian12-arm64: 1 error(s) occurred:

  • Post-processor failed: Unknown artifact type, can’t build box: vagrant
    2025/04/27 21:35:53 ui:
    ==> Builds finished but no artifacts were created.
    2025/04/27 21:35:53 [INFO] (telemetry) Finalizing.
    2025/04/27 21:35:54 waiting for all plugin processes to complete…
    2025/04/27 21:35:54 /opt/homebrew/bin/packer: plugin process exited
    2025/04/27 21:35:54 /Users/rwideman/.config/packer/plugins/github.com/hashicorp/vagrant/packer-plugin-vagrant_v1.1.5_x5.0_darwin_arm64: plugin process exited
    2025/04/27 21:35:54 /opt/homebrew/bin/packer: plugin process exited
    2025/04/27 21:35:54 [ERR] Error decoding response stream 14: EOF
    2025/04/27 21:35:54 /Users/rwideman/.config/packer/plugins/github.com/hashicorp/vagrant/packer-plugin-vagrant_v1.1.5_x5.0_darwin_arm64: plugin process exited